(03-28-2016 10:10 PM)Memphis Blazer Wrote:  Everyone says we were paying a million to Haase this past year. That's not quite true since he was giving some back to pay the cost of attendance. I don't know how much that was.

I also saw somewhere that he was only paid $850,000 base last year. Maybe over a million with incentives.

Just because he was donating some money back doesn't mean he wasn't being paid that money in the first place.

Coach Haase 2015-16 Compensation

University Compensation:
$850,000 Base Pay
$75,000 Radio/TV talent Fee
$75,000 promotional and Fund Raising Fee
$1,000,000

Bonuses:
$50,000 - Regular Season Championship
$35,000 - Conference Coach of the Year
$15,000 - NIT invitation
$100,000

Total Compensation: $1,100,000 not accounting for non-monetary benefits, outside compensation and possible APR bonuses.
